Insurance Brokers Remuneration Report

Hewitt CSi's Insurance Brokers Remuneration Report is a detailed analysis of market remuneration and benefits rates for roles within the Australian insurance broking sector. Market intelligence within the report is used by each participating organisation to set salary levels that are aligned with the pay rates offered in the market, thereby ensuring that business profitability is not compromised by overspending on salaries and talented employees are not lost from the organisation as a result of underspending on salaries.

The report was first produced in October 2005 at the request of several insurance broking organisations. Due to the success of the report, Hewitt CSi now produces an Insurance Brokers Remuneration Report annually in November each year.

The November 2007 survey contains:

  • 1801 lines of salaries and benefits data related to individual employees within 5 leading insurance broking organisations
  • Comprehensive remuneration and benefits market data tables for 8 insurance broking roles
  • Graphical comparisons of the published roles within each job family
  • Analysis of the prevalence of benefits and variable pay for each published roles
